================ Comment at: clang/lib/CodeGen/TargetInfo.cpp:4205 + +class PPCAIX32TargetCodeGenInfo : public TargetCodeGenInfo { +public: ---------------- sfertile wrote: > Xiangling_L wrote: > > I have a question here. AIX32 falls into PPC32 target, so why we don't > > inherit from `PPC32TargetCodeGenInfo` instead? > Do we need a separate AIX specific class? We are implementing 2 functions, 1 > of which is the same implementation as its `PPC32TargetCodeGenInfo` > counterpart. If we have access to the triple, we can return true when the OS > is AIX in `PPC32TargetCodeGenInfo::initDwarfEHRegSizeTable`. With the > implementations being nearly identical (and after enabling > DwarfEHRegSizeTable they will be identical) I think we are better to not add > a new class if we can avoid it. Not adding a new class makes sense to me if we are sure that `DwarfEHRegSizeTable` will be identical/viable for AIX.
